This section is designed for those involved in the technical running of track & field competitions and the production of equipment used at athletics events.

The IAAF Handbook provides the Rules for athletic competitions.

The Certified Products lists are items that have been tested and approved under the guidelines of the IAAF Certification System.

For those who wish to submit their equipment or surfacing material for testing by the IAAF, see the Certification procedures.

For those involved in track construction, please look at the IAAF Performance Specifications for Synthetic Surfaced Athletics Tracks (Outdoor). The Track Survey Report form is also available for competition technical facilities where only the measurement of the track is certified to be fully in accordance with IAAF Rule 134.

Further information can be obtained from the IAAF Track and Field Facilities Manual that can be purchased from the IAAF for a cost of 100USD.

For athletic event organisers, should a World Record be broken at your event, see the World Record application forms to be submitted to the IAAF.
